How to Identify Which App Is Legit For Loan in Kenya

Check Licensing and Registration

The first step to verify which app is legit for loan is checking if it is registered with the relevant authorities. Legitimate mobile lenders in Kenya must operate under the regulation of the Central Bank of Kenya (CBK) and have proper licensing. Always verify this by visiting the CBK website or the app’s official site for licensing information. Avoid apps that operate anonymously or lack clear registration details, as they could be illegal or scams.

Research User Reviews and Ratings

Customer feedback provides real insights into a loan app’s legitimacy. Platforms like Google Play Store, App Store, and independent review sites offer valuable user experiences. Look for consistent positive reviews highlighting transparency, ease of borrowing, and prompt disbursements. Be cautious of apps with numerous complaints about hidden charges, delays, or difficulty in repayments.

Assess Transparency and Easy Terms

A legit app clearly states loan terms upfront, including interest rates, repayment schedules, and penalties. Avoid platforms that hide fees or provide vague information. Transparency builds trust and ensures you’re fully aware of your commitments before borrowing.

Examine Security Features

Security is paramount when sharing personal and financial data. Trustworthy apps provide secure sign-in protocols, encryption, and privacy policies aligned with industry standards. Always ensure the app uses SSL encryption and has a privacy policy you can access easily.

Look for Customer Support and Contact Information

Reliable lenders offer accessible customer support channels, such as phone numbers, emails, or live chat. This demonstrates accountability and makes it easier to resolve issues or clarify doubts about loans.

Steps to Safely Borrow From Mobile Loan Apps

Being cautious when borrowing from any app is essential. Follow these steps to ensure your money and data are protected:

  • Verify the app’s licensing and regulatory compliance.
  • Read all loan terms and conditions thoroughly before signing up.
  • Do not share personal PINs or passwords with anyone.
  • Ensure your device has updated security features and antivirus software.
  • Keep records of all transactions and communications with the lender.

Moreover, always borrow within your means and prioritize repayment to maintain a healthy credit score. Frequently Asked Questions About Which App Is Legit For Loan

Q1. How can I tell if a mobile loan app is regulated in Kenya?

A1. Check if the app is registered with the Central Bank of Kenya (CBK) or displays licensing information clearly. Legitimate apps will be transparent about their regulatory status.

Q2. Are there risks involved in using mobile loan apps in Kenya?

A2. Yes, risks include fraud, high interest rates, or hidden charges. Always verify app credentials, read reviews, and avoid sharing sensitive information with unverified platforms.

Q4. What should I do if I experience issues with a loan app?

A4. Contact the app’s customer support immediately, document all interactions, and if unresolved, report to relevant authorities such as CBK or consumer protection agencies in Kenya.
